Detailed the arches and underside on the Zed today...few piccies

Well the weather's been fantastic, so what better way to spend the day than under the car! LOL

 

Pics aren't that great quality. Anyway, I thoroughly cleaned out the arches and the wheels.

 

Dressed the arch liners. I'd previously painted up the non-plastic parts with satin black hammerite to make it all look new. I cleaned up the calipers, attacked them with autosol, redid all the lettering and painted up the non-contact surfaces on the disks.

 

Makes a lovely difference and makes the rims appear brighter. Allso go underneath and cleaned up the petrol tank and polished up the exhaust.
